Brain temperature; Temperature monitoring; Entropy
Brain temperature plays a crucial role in cognitive functionality and the outcomes of brain diseases, particularly in regard to amyloid beta aggregation in Alzheimer's disease.
Brain temperature determines not only an individual's cognitive functionality but also the prognosis and mor-tality rates of many brain diseases. More specifically, brain temperature not only changes in response to different physiological events like yawning and stretching, but also plays a significant pathophysiological role in a number of neurological and neuropsychiatric illnesses. Here, we have outlined the function of brain hyperthermia in both diseased and healthy states, focusing particularly on the amyloid beta aggregation in Alzheimer's disease.
